RSM and ANN were evaluated for prediction of physical and chemical properties of industrial hemp extracts prepared using MAE. The effects of liquid to solid ratio, ethanol content, extraction time, extraction temperature, and microwave power were analyzed. ANN had better prediction performance for both physical and chemical properties. Optimal conditions based on RSM wereL/S = 30 mL/g,v/v = 25%,t= 25 min,T= 45 degrees C andP= 600 W. Under those conditions, dynamic of the extraction process was analyzed using six kinetic models and showed that the extraction rate reached constant value after approximately 15 min.
